Transaction e31916b88831ac52c939baf37dde6c1374aae7d3bcab163dfc9263f1c38fa55d
2 Input
1 Outputs
- e31916b88831ac52c939baf37dde6c1374aae7d3bcab163dfc9263f1c38fa55d:0
value 973622
address bc1pjendvzcvwchfm0jjfge6nt5gz427dmuckr099nc94jqp75yxzhwqmahdur